Transaction 30ec6768349948b5a73a1f6ed23247d9a9fa2bb39bcf75a50ee090de36204b20
1 Input
1 Output
-
30ec6768349948b5a73a1f6ed23247d9a9fa2bb39bcf75a50ee090de36204b20:0
- value
- 16911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66613543d5c6bece6b134cdaf780ced0a575657e OP_EQUAL
- address
- 3B2MJFBVDCka33dUSbFkCR9SesJrJSwjwS